Subject: Veltara Line Pricing — Final Call

Team,

Veltara pricing locks Friday. Tiered model stays: Core, Plus, Summit. List prices up 6% across the board; no exceptions for legacy Harwick accounts. Discount authority capped at 12% without my sign-off. Sales leads: brief your teams before Monday, and do not circulate the margin sheet outside this group. Competitive pressure from Quonset Labs is real but we hold the line this quarter. The strategic rationale is summarized in the note below.

board note of kageg-bahof: The renewal with Holwynax Holdings closes at $2 million a year, 5 percent below the last contract. Project Ulaath slips by two quarters because of the supplier delay.

### Runbook: BounceBroom — Account Recovery

If the BounceBroom email bounce processor loses access to its service account, do not create a new one. First, pause the intake queue so bounces buffer safely. Then open the recovery console and select the BounceBroom principal. Verification requires approval from the on-call lead. Once approved, the console prompts for the stored recovery credentials; enter the passphrase that appears directly below this paragraph.

recovery phrase for fahof-kahap: holion-gormir-jorix-istix-briwyn-sorael

**Ticket FAB-208: Expired credentials — Mockforge test-data factory**

Support team: the Mockforge library stopped seeding staging databases this morning. Root cause is an expired API key for the internal Seedbank service, which Mockforge calls to pull anonymized fixture templates. Affected customers will see `factory init failed` errors. A replacement key has been provisioned and confirmed working. When responding to tickets, direct engineers to update their Mockforge config with the key below.

gateway credential: qvz15-KH6w5OvQFD1Z8FT